		<description><![CDATA[The New Orleans Hornets apparently were close to having a deal in place to send guard Devin Brown (notes) to the Minnesota Timberwolves for Jason Hart (notes) , but the two sides couldn't get it to work out financially, according to the New Orleans Times-Picayune. The Hornets apparently asked Brown to give up some of the cash he had coming to him so the deal could work but he wouldn't do it. The money was contained in trade bonus in his contract that gives Brown a payout of 10 percent of his $1.1 million salary if he gets traded. ]]></description>

		<description><![CDATA[With the economy not as strong as it once was, the NBA was bracing itself before the season got started for a lot of empty seats. But things have gone much better than expected, which is making all those players that will become free agents this summer very happy because it means that the salary cap certainly won't drop as much as some were expecting]]></description>
			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>With the economy not as strong as it once was, the NBA was bracing itself before the season got started for a lot of empty seats. But things have gone much better than expected, which is making all those players that will become free agents this summer very happy because it means that the salary cap certainly won&#8217;t drop as much as some were expecting.
<p>Some had thought that salary-cap drop could be a<a href="http://espn.go.com/blog/truehoop/post/_/id/11723/what-will-next-summers-salary-cap-be" target="_blank">s much as $6 million or $7 million</a>, according to ESPN, but that seems like an outsize number at this point. It is still expected that the cap will drop while simultaneously the streets swell the number of talented free agents becoming available this summer.</p>
<p>The current salary cap is $57.7 million and ESPN has dug up what a few teams are projecting to be the numbers for next season as they plan out their free-agent-signing strategies: The <a href="http://sports.yahoo.com/nba/teams/mia/">Miami Heat</a> apparently has the biggest projected drop in the cap and is planning around a budget of $52 million. Meanwhile, the <a href="http://sports.yahoo.com/nba/teams/nyk/">New York Knicks</a> are banking on the number being closer to $53 million. And the <a href="http://sports.yahoo.com/nba/teams/njn/">New Jersey Nets</a> are hoping things don&#8217;t drop that much and are projecting a budget of between $54 million and $55 million to work with.</p>

		<description><![CDATA[Las Vegas Mayor Oscar Goodman is apparently spending a fair amount of time working to get an NBA team to his city, according to the Las Vegas Sun. But first he needs an arena. The city is about to sign a deal to have a feasibility study done for a downtown 20,000-seat, $145 million arena to be built and Goodman believes that once that arena is built, the city will get a team, based on conversations Goodman has had with NBA execs]]></description>

		<description><![CDATA[It appears that any friendship that Magic Johnson and Isiah Thomas once had is over. Johnson says all sorts of unpleasant stuff about Thomas in his new book, &#34;When the Game was Ours.&#34; According to the New York Post, Johnson's book alleges that Thomas went around the league spreading the rumor and trying to find proof that Magic was gay or bisexual after Johnson announced that he had HIV. Magic admits in the book that he went out of his way to blackball Thomas off of the initial Dream Team in 1992 that went on to win the gold medal at the Olympics in Barcelona]]></description>
